60 Ah is enough !!

Volkswagen and Audi have put 60 Ah, 70 Ah and 72 Ah batteries in 2.0 TFSI cars.
Size isn't the only thing that matters. Take care to go for high quality battery.

I'd only go for more than 60 Ah if I had an additional heater.
